Drawing on the principles and research from industrial/organizational (I/O) psychology and best practices from human resources (HR) management, this book will help civilian employers improve the way that they locate, hire, and retain military veterans and military spouses. Each chapter provides accessible guidance founded in research and data from leaders and experts to help companies maximize the benefits of veteran employees. This book offers a summary of best in class practices that will enable veteran employers and employees to thrive.
Nathan D. Ainspan, Ph.D., has researched, written, and spoken extensively about military-civilian transitions and veterans' civilian employment. He is currently the Senior Research Psychologist with the Military-Civilian Transition Office (MCTO) at the Department of Defense. His work focuses on improving civilian employment opportunities for returning service members and the psychosocial benefits that employment provides to wounded warriors and injured veterans.
Kristin N. Saboe, Ph.D. is an Army veteran, nationally recognized leader, award-winning psychologist, public speaker, and strategist. While an officer and Research Psychologist in the Army, she deployed to Afghanistan and served as a staff officer at the Pentagon. Her writing, research, and community involvement focuses on veteran and military spouse employment, human performance optimization, leadership, and well-being in both military and civilian settings.
